The following figure shows the setup of the Active Directory objects
in multiple domains for RAC. In this scenario, you have two DRAC 4
cards (RAC1 and RAC2) and three existing Active Directory users (User1,
User2, and User3). User1 is in Domain1, but User2 and User3 are in
Domain2. You want to give User1 and User2 Administrator privileges
on both the RAC1 and RAC2 card and give User3 Login privilege on the
RAC2 card.
